Just watched this Polygon demo of Sonic Mania and it looks like Sonic 3's giant rings are back. Or something. The person playing dicked around and looked for secrets, when they pushed a rock in Green Hill they fell into a chamber with a giant wireframe ring. https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=fEfKC4sxTG8 It's not clear whether it's like that because it's deactivated for the demo build or because they didn't have 50 rings or something. I hope this is the emerald method, I prefer it to the "have 50 rings and hit checkpoint/finish stage" one. E: They found one in Studiopolis too with over 50 rings and it was still wireframe so it was probably deactivated for the demo build, or there's some other esoteric criterion. That's the fun part- I apparently massively miscalculated and it requires much too much obscure knowledge of both franchises, so it doesn't work for either audience! Megaman has its own lengthy history of conflict over the names of characters. Names in the classic series were all styled "Thing Man". The X series started getting weird, starting with a convention of "Thing" + "Animal name". This hit its peak with a game where the translators renamed all the bosses to be references to Guns'n'Roses. Independently, Mega Man X1 had a boss named "Boomer Kuwanger" who is actually some sort of beetle, a fact that confused everyone back in the day-weird translation again. What kind of animal is a "Kuwanger"? Later series, like the one from which the robot in the image come from, are more and more incomprehensible.The robot pictured spits and creates eggs as its attacks. Its actual name is "Popla Cocapetri", which sounds like a kind of food-borne illness. Also it let me write "robowang". I guess what I'm saying is however bad sonic fans have it, don't forget what Mega Man fans deal with. Discendo Vox fucked around with this message at 16:25 on Sep 7, 2016 |
